Defining Private Label Strategy
A private label strategy involves a brand creating and selling products under its own label, but manufactured by a third party. This approach allows brands to offer exclusive products, control pricing, and differentiate themselves from competitors. For direct-to-consumer brands, utilizing a private label strategy can be a strategic move to enter the retail space with unique, high-quality products.

Benefits of Private Label Strategy
The benefits of applying a private label strategy are numerous and can significantly impact a brand’s success in the retail landscape. Some of the advantages include:
– Increased brand visibility and recognition through exclusive product offerings
– Enhanced control over product quality, pricing, and profitability
– Greater flexibility to adapt to market trends and consumer preferences
– Strengthened brand loyalty as customers recognize the unique value of private label products
Challenges and Solutions
As with any business strategy, implementing a private label strategy comes with its own set of challenges. However, these challenges can be effectively addressed with the right approach:
– Quality Control: Working closely with reputable manufacturers and conducting thorough quality assurance processes can mitigate this risk.
– Market Differentiation: Developing a compelling brand story and positioning the private label products as superior options can help address this challenge.
– Distribution Channels: Strategic partnerships and innovative distribution models can help direct-to-consumer brands penetrate the national retail market successfully.
